Keep Employee Performance Reviews Successful

Most organizations use some form of employee performance reviews as a formal setting to discuss expectations. These reviews are important to both the employee and supervisor since they provide information about employee performance. An article written by Donald Nickels and published by PayScale.com provides employers with 5 keys to successful employee performance reviews:

  • Timeliness – It is important that employee performance reviews are completed on time because timeliness speaks volumes about how one’s work it regarded.
  • Employee Input – Employee reviews are a two person process where employee input is absolutely vital.
  • Discuss The Negative – Employee performance review time is the perfect opportunity to discuss poor performance.
  • Goal Setting – After reviewing past performance with the employee, it is a good idea for the supervisor and employee to set goals possibly on a quarterly or annual basis.
  • Make It 360 – You can improve the employee review effectiveness by asking for feedback on how expectations are communicated.
